Managing database triggers with SQL CLI

Triggers are an essential feature of databases that allow you to execute a set of actions automatically in response to specific events, such as inserting, updating, or deleting data. Although triggers are commonly managed through graphical user interfaces, it is also possible to manage them using the SQL Command Line Interface (CLI). In this blog post, we will explore how to create, modify, and delete triggers using the SQL CLI.

Creating a Trigger

To create a new trigger, you need to know the table and event (insert, update, or delete) the trigger will respond to, as well as the actions it should perform. With the SQL CLI, you can use the CREATE TRIGGER statement to define a trigger. Here’s an example:

CREATE TRIGGER my_trigger
AFTER INSERT
ON my_table
FOR EACH ROW
BEGIN
  -- Trigger actions go here
  -- ...
END;

In this example, we create a trigger named my_trigger that fires after an INSERT event occurs on the my_table table. The FOR EACH ROW clause indicates that the trigger will execute for each affected row. Replace the -- Trigger actions go here comment with the actions you want the trigger to perform.

Deleting a Trigger

To remove a trigger from the database, you can use the DROP TRIGGER statement. Here’s an example:

DROP TRIGGER my_trigger;

This command will delete the my_trigger trigger from the database. Make sure to specify the correct trigger name.
